Hardware vs. Software: Memahami Perbedaan dan Fungsinya

Dalam dunia teknologi, kita sering mendengar istilah hardware dan software. Keduanya adalah dua elemen yang tak terpisahkan dan bekerja sama untuk menjalankan sebuah perangkat. Namun, apa sebenarnya perbedaan mendasar antara keduanya? Memahami ini penting, baik bagi pengguna awam maupun mereka yang berkecimpung di bidang teknologi.


Apa itu Hardware?

Hardware adalah segala komponen fisik yang membentuk sebuah perangkat. Sederhananya, ini adalah bagian yang bisa kita lihat, sentuh, dan pegang. Hardware merupakan “otak” dan “tulang” dari sebuah sistem komputer. Contohnya termasuk monitor, keyboard, mouse, printer, speaker, dan semua komponen internal seperti Central Processing Unit (CPU), RAM (Random Access Memory), hard drive, dan kartu grafis. Hardware berperan sebagai fondasi, menyediakan media fisik tempat software dapat diinstal dan dijalankan. Tanpa hardware, software tidak memiliki tempat untuk “hidup.”

Fungsi utama hardware adalah menerima input, memproses data, dan menghasilkan output. Misalnya, saat Anda mengetik di keyboard (hardware), sinyal input dikirim ke CPU (hardware) untuk diproses, dan hasilnya ditampilkan di monitor (hardware). Setiap komponen hardware memiliki peran spesifik untuk memastikan sistem bekerja secara efisien. Kualitas dan spesifikasi hardware sangat menentukan seberapa cepat dan andal sebuah perangkat.


Apa itu Software?

Sebaliknya, software adalah sekumpulan instruksi, data, atau program yang memberitahu hardware apa yang harus dilakukan. Software adalah bagian non-fisik dari perangkat. Kita tidak bisa menyentuh atau memegangnya, tetapi kita bisa melihat dan berinteraksi dengannya melalui antarmuka pengguna di layar. Software merupakan “jiwa” atau “pikiran” dari sebuah sistem.

Ada dua kategori utama software:

  1. Sistem Operasi (OS): Ini adalah software fundamental yang mengelola semua sumber daya hardware dan software lainnya. Contohnya termasuk Windows, macOS, Android, dan iOS. Tanpa sistem operasi, hardware tidak akan tahu cara berinteraksi dengan pengguna atau menjalankan program lain.
  2. Aplikasi (Application Software): Ini adalah program yang dirancang untuk tugas-tugas spesifik. Contohnya adalah Microsoft Word (untuk mengolah kata), Google Chrome (untuk menjelajahi internet), dan berbagai game, editor foto, atau aplikasi perbankan. Aplikasi berjalan di atas sistem operasi dan memungkinkan pengguna untuk melakukan pekerjaan sehari-hari.

Sinergi yang Tak Terpisahkan

Hubungan antara hardware dan software dapat dianalogikan seperti hubungan antara tubuh manusia (hardware) dan pikiran atau jiwa (software). Tubuh memiliki kemampuan fisik (misalnya, tangan untuk memegang), tetapi tanpa pikiran, ia tidak akan tahu apa yang harus dipegang atau mengapa. Begitu pula, hardware memiliki kemampuan pemrosesan, tetapi tanpa software, ia hanyalah tumpukan komponen elektronik yang tidak berguna.

Software memberikan perintah kepada hardware untuk memproses data. Hardware kemudian melaksanakan perintah tersebut. Keduanya harus bekerja dalam harmoni. Jika salah satu bermasalah, seluruh sistem akan terganggu. Misalnya, jika hard drive (hardware) rusak, sistem operasi (software) tidak bisa dimuat. Sebaliknya, jika ada bug pada software, ia bisa menyebabkan hardware menjadi tidak stabil atau tidak berfungsi dengan baik.


Kesimpulan

Jadi, perbedaan utama antara hardware dan software terletak pada sifatnya: hardware adalah fisik dan berwujud, sementara software adalah non-fisik dan berisi instruksi. Meskipun berbeda, keduanya mutlak diperlukan. Hardware menyediakan infrastruktur fisik, dan software memberikan kecerdasan operasional. Keduanya adalah dua sisi dari koin yang sama, esensial untuk berjalannya setiap perangkat digital. Memahami peran masing-masing adalah langkah pertama untuk menjadi pengguna teknologi yang lebih cerdas.

Kunjungi website kami disini.